Suppliers Like GM More
By Staff -- Purchasing, 8/16/2007
Suppliers are starting to warm up to GM, according to results of the 7th annual North American OEM-Tier 1 supplier working relations study. In late 2005, Bo Andersson, group vice president, global purchasing and supply chain, announced a program to improve relations with suppliers and it appears to be working. "In the 15 years, we've been doing this study, we have never seen such a dramatic improvement," says John W. Henke, Jr., president and CEO of Planning Perspectives, which conducted the study. Still, suppliers like working with Toyota, Honda and Nissan better.
